Stay VAT-compliant in Belgium
E-invoicing is steadily becoming the standard in Europe, and from 1st of January 2026, all Belgian B2B marketplace transactions must use VAT-valid e-invoices via Peppol. Monta generates and sends them automatically, helping you stay compliant with no manual work
